County Institute to Be Held Week of Aug. 30th.
The county teachers institute will be held this year during the week beginning Aug. 30th, which in general respects is much better than the plan of'the past two years of holding it in October or November, so soon after the schools of~ the county had started that it proved a serious interruption in school work. The program begins Monday, Aug. 30th, at 1 p. m. The program as gotten out by County Superintendent Lamson mentions President Bryan, of Indiana University as a lecturer, Miss Stover as the music instructor and a Miss Robinson as a lecturer. Also that several prominent educators from over the state have promised to be here during the week. The county superintendent is allowed SIOO for holding the institute and in addition to this and for paying the expenses all teachers who attend are assessed. The daily sessions are from 9 to 11:45 and from 1:30 to 4. The reception vill be held Tuesday evening in the high school building. The only other evening session will be Thursday. A preliminary meeting of the township teachers will be held Saturday morning, Sept. 4th, at 9:30 to organize the township 'nstitute work and teachers are asked not to plan to go home until Saturday afternoon. Township trustees and members of school >oards are invited to attend the sessions.
